热门标签 | HotTags
当前位置:  开发笔记 > 数据库 > 正文

wordpress数据库怎么优化和清理冗余数据

我们可以使用SQL语句来优化清理数据,例如使用“DELETEFROM`wp_posts`WHERE`wp_posts`.`post_content`”来删除内容为空、标题为空的文章。

DELETE FROM `wp_posts` WHERE `wp_posts`.`post_content` = '';
DELETE FROM `wp_posts` WHERE `wp_posts`.`post_title` = '';
DELETE FROM `wp_posts` WHERE `post_type` = 'revision';
DELETE FROM `wp_postmeta` WHERE `meta_key` = '_edit_lock';
DELETE FROM `wp_postmeta` WHERE `meta_key` = '_edit_last';

另外对于上面没有提到的一个表说明一下,wp_commentmeta,这个表是Akismet插件保存的垃圾信息记录,这个表如果长时间不清理的话,你会发现它要比其他表大的多,因此,像这个表,我的建议是,定期清空,SQL语句如下:

TRUNCATE TABLE `wp_commentmeta`

推荐教程:WordPress教程

以上就是wordpress数据库怎么优化和清理冗余数据的详细内容,更多请关注其它相关文章!


推荐阅读
author-avatar
拯救僵尸网店
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有